(ANSA) - ROME, MAY 19 - In the first two months of 2022, 1,208,219 new employment contracts were activated while 943,329 were terminated with a positive balance of 264,890 contracts.
The INPS notes this in the Observatory on precarious work, underlining that the net change is positive for over 125 thousand units in permanent contracts (hires plus transformations, fewer terminations of stable contracts), an increase compared to the 86,762 of the previous year when it was in force the freeze on redundancies.
The balance of permanent contracts was positive especially in January (+105,416) while in February it was +19,804.
